(n.) any of many possible creatures that dwell in pubic hair; an insult implying that someone is of little importance or stature and/or is irritating
I had to go to the doctor's. These pueblecites were causing me to itch too much.

I'm tired of that annoying little publecite.
by DemonMoses January 01, 2012